Output 5a374c3b306f7be1b67f51d02ba96fdddb683ddcdc982a08acbca80986b0f694:0

value
10669152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db02c6f886e3c930109fe0e82a9d569e2689168a OP_EQUAL
address
3Mf3EX7GCZb7iN4KkAfHhut8DMQ2c3i3gE
transaction
5a374c3b306f7be1b67f51d02ba96fdddb683ddcdc982a08acbca80986b0f694
spent
true